Collect the movie tokens to unlock these missions...

Blues Brothers, 1974 Dodge Monaco
Bullitt, 1968 Ford Mustang GT Fastback
Cannonball Run, 1978 Lamborghini Countach LP400S
Dukes of Hazard, 1969 Dodge Charger R/T
Gone In 60 Seconds, 1973 Ford Mustang Mach I
Redline, 2011 McLaren MP4-12C
Smokey & The Bandit, 1977 Pontiac TransAm Firebird
Starsky & Hutch, 1974 Dodge Monaco Cop
Test Drive, 1987 RUF CT-R Yellow Bird
The Driver, 1965 Chevrolet S-10
The French Connection, 1971 Pontiac LeMans
The Italian Job, 1972 Lamborghini Miura
Vanishing Point, 1970 Dodge Challenger R/T
